    Australia’s largest airline Qantas Airways Limited (ASX:QAN) has launched a new business rewards program named Aquire. The program is aimed at small and medium businesses and will complement its existing Frequent Flyer program which was adjusted last week. 


     


    Qantas says businesses will now be able to earn Aquire Points offered by participating partners including Westpac Banking Corporation (ASX:WBC), GIO Business Insurance and Deloitte Private. 


     


    Aquire Points can then be converted to Qantas Points and redeemed for employees or individuals for flights and upgrades, hotel bookings, or items from the Qantas Store. 


     


    While it has been a tumultuous start to the year for Qantas Airways the company’s shares lifted 0.91 per cent over the first quarter to end yesterday at $1.11. 


     


    Qantas Airways reported a net loss of $235 million in the first half of the 2014 financial year.
